Towball download is the vertical load that a coupled trailer applies to the vehicle's towball. It is also called towball mass, nose weight, or tongue weight in different markets.

A separate and shared limit

The permitted download can be limited by the vehicle, tow hitch, coupling, or trailer. Use the lowest applicable rating. It is separate from the trailer's total mass, but it normally contributes to the tow vehicle's payload and affects its rear-axle load.

Loading the trailer changes the download. Too little or too much vertical load can harm stability, steering, braking, or axle loading, so cargo placement must follow the vehicle and trailer manufacturers' instructions. A generic percentage is not a substitute for those requirements because trailer types and regional rules differ.

Check the rating for the exact variant and factory-approved towing equipment. Accessories fitted behind the rear axle and cargo already in the vehicle can further reduce the available axle and payload margin. See Towing with an Electric Vehicle for the complete towing-load calculation.
